The gallinaceous game birds of North America, including the partridges, grouse, ptarmigan, and wild turkeys .. . is proved by the few white 16s 166 GAME BIRDS OF NORTH AMERICA. feathers scattered among the black ones, and also by the whiteforehead. In the perfect breeding plumage these white featherswould probably be absent. Adult Female in Sieiiimer.—Entire plumage of body, ochrace-ous, palest on the throat, blotched and barred on the back withblack, and the feathers having white tips; on the breast andflanks the black blotches are much fewer, but the black bars arebroader, and there are no white tips on the breast feathers, butthose on the abdomen and some on the flanks are broadly tippedwith white; under tail-coverts, ochraceous, barred with black;the tertials, inner secondaries, and some of the greater wing-coverts, ochraceous, like the back, barred and tipped with white;remainder of wing and primaries, pure white, with the shafts ofthe latter, pale brown; bill and claws, black. Total length,i2| inches; wing, b-^^; tail, 4|; tarsus, i|; exposed culmen, ^^. In winter both sexes turn
